Demand is surging for DigitalOcean&#8217;s AI solutions          <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">Most businesses don&#8217;t have billions of dollars to build AI data centers, so they rent computing capacity from <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fool.com\/investing\/stock-market\/market-sectors\/information-technology\/cloud-stocks\/?utm_source=yahoo-host-full&amp;utm_medium=feed&amp;utm_campaign=article&amp;referring_guid=d6bdb37e-087b-470f-bd70-fe0c0879873c\" data-ylk=\"slk:cloud%20providers;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as;source:content-canvas%20default\" data-yga=\"{&quot;yLinkText&quot;:&quot;cloud providers&quot;,&quot;yLinkElement&quot;:&quot;context_link&quot;,&quot;yModuleName&quot;:&quot;content-canvas&quot;,&quot;yTrafficOrigin&quot;:&quot;content-canvas default&quot;}\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\">cloud providers<\/a> instead and only pay for what they use. While Amazon, Microsoft, and Alphabet are busy chasing the highest-spending customers, DigitalOcean is sticking to what it knows: affordable solutions for small and midsized business (SMB) customers.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">DigitalOcean has always offered a basic set of cloud services at low prices and highly personalized technical support, delivered via a simple dashboard for easy deployment. It&#8217;s applying the same blueprint to its expanding suite of <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fool.com\/investing\/stock-market\/market-sectors\/information-technology\/ai-stocks\/?utm_source=yahoo-host-full&amp;utm_medium=feed&amp;utm_campaign=article&amp;referring_guid=d6bdb37e-087b-470f-bd70-fe0c0879873c\" data-ylk=\"slk:AI;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as;source:content-canvas%20default\" data-yga=\"{&quot;yLinkText&quot;:&quot;AI&quot;,&quot;yLinkElement&quot;:&quot;context_link&quot;,&quot;yModuleName&quot;:&quot;content-canvas&quot;,&quot;yTrafficOrigin&quot;:&quot;content-canvas default&quot;}\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\">AI<\/a> services through a new platform called AI-Native Cloud, which features five distinct layers to help businesses deploy AI software.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">Infrastructure is the foundation layer, and it includes 20 data centers housing thousands of chips from suppliers such as Nvidia and Advanced Micro Devices. Another layer is the &#8220;inference engine,&#8221; which provides access to foundation models from leading AI developers such as OpenAI and Anthropic, as well as over 70 open-source models. Businesses can use these to power their AI agents, chatbots, and other applications, an affordable alternative to building their own models from scratch.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">The inference router, a feature of the inference engine, can analyze prompts and route them to the most suitable model, optimizing for both intelligence and cost. This is an innovative way DigitalOcean is helping its cost-conscious customers save money.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">At the conclusion of the second quarter of 2026 (ended June 30), DigitalOcean had $894 million in remaining performance obligations (RPO), up by a staggering 12-fold from the year-ago period. This effectively represents a backlog of customers waiting for more data center capacity to come online, indicating a large pipeline of demand.  <\/p>\n<p>    Story Continues  <\/p>\n<p>        Accelerating revenue growth         <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">DigitalOcean generated a record $281.2 million in revenue during the second quarter, up 29% from the year-ago period. That was more than double the 14% growth rate the company delivered in the same quarter last year, highlighting its significant AI-driven momentum.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">DigitalOcean also ended the quarter with $1.1 billion in annual recurring revenue (ARR). AI customers specifically accounted for $234 million of that total, an eye-popping 212% year-over-year increase.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">DigitalOcean&#8217;s recent results have been so strong that management is already forecasting over 50% total revenue growth for 2027.
